  • This is a example of repetition. The author has Lennie keep saying that he doesn't want any trouble from Curley
  • "I don't want to trouble George. I didn't do none, I never want'd no trouble." (Steinbeck 24).
  • This is a example of a simile. where the author uses the word "like" to compare Lennie drinking the water to a horse.
  • "...drank with long gulps, snorting into the water like a horse," (Steinbeck 3).
  • This is foreshadowing. I think something will happen between Lennie and Curlys wife later in the book.
  • " "She's real purdy," said Lennie," (Steinbeck 28).
